A Study Comparing Upadacitinib (ABT-494) to Placebo and to Adalimumab in Adults With Rheumatoid Arthritis Who Are on a Stable Dose of Methotrexate and Who Have an Inadequate Response to Methotrexate

What it studies

Condition

  • Rheumatoid Arthritis

Interventions

  • Drug: Placebo for Adalimumab
  • Drug: Adalimumab — also filed as Humira
  • Drug: Placebo for Upadacitinib
  • Drug: Upadacitinib — also filed as ABT-494

Primary outcomes

what the primary-completion date above is the date OF
Percentage of Participants With an American College of Rheumatology 20% (ACR20) Response at Week 12
measured Baseline and Week 12
Percentage of Participants Achieving Clinical Remission (CR) Based on DAS28(CRP) at Week 12
measured Week 12
